Output 33ca33e42f4566c80d667d3f18b2b7efd6a15e1c0c1887ff11bb5c3669de6f51:0

value
540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a73352ace335ba4a89be3636bac48a6974689e3 OP_EQUAL
address
3CrUNiZHcJxqBgFtUsAidkxudS7YngK7Lu
transaction
33ca33e42f4566c80d667d3f18b2b7efd6a15e1c0c1887ff11bb5c3669de6f51
confirmations
509913
spent
true